Description

When dogs are diagnosed with a serious illness, ensuring their nutritional needs are met is critical. Prescription Diet ON-Care is designed to help maintain strength and energy as well as encourage eating from the very first bowl.

Please contact your vet to see if this is the right food for your dog.

Hill's nutritionists and veterinarians developed the nutrition of Hill's Prescription Diet ON-Care to specifically help nourish and support dogs fighting serious illness. This delicious dry food is made with chicken, flavourful fats and highly digestible protein, to give your dog a great mealtime experience.

The highly digestible nutrients in Prescription Diet ON-Care are easy for pets to absorb and the formula also contains ActivBiome+, a proprietary blend of prebiotic fibers to support a healthy GI microbiome and proven to promote consistent stool quality.


Primary Indications:

  • Neoplasia

Other Indications:

  • Anorexia
  • Cachexia & weight loss
  • Debility, malnutrition & convalescence
  • Hypermetabolic states
  • Surgery (Pre- and Post-Op)

Not recommended for:

  • Growing puppies, pregnant or nursing dogs.
  • Patients with kidney disease, hyperlipidemia, pancreatitis, history of pancreatits or at risk of pancreatitis.

Key Benefits

  • Designed to encourage eating, starting with the first bowl
  • Optimal nutrition rich in calories to help support your dog's daily activity
  • Designed to support stool quality
  • S+OXSHIELD: Formulated to promote a urinary environment that reduces the risk of developing struvite & calcium oxalate crystals

INGREDIENTS

  • with Chicken: Maize, chicken (12%) and turkey meal, wheat, animal fat, maize gluten meal, digest, barley, oats, fish oil, ground pecan shell, soybean oil, minerals, dried beet pulp, flaxseed, dried citrus pulp, vitamins, dried cranberries, trace elements and beta-carotene. With a natural antioxidant (mixed tocopherols).

ANALYTICAL CONSTITUENTS:

  • Protein 24.8%, Fat content 21.9%, Crude fibre 2.3%, Crude ash 4.8%, Calcium 0.79%, Phosphorus 0.61%, Sodium 0.21%, Potassium 0.69%, Magnesium 0.09%; per kg: Vitamin A 9,159IU, Vitamin D3 720IU, Vitamin E 550mg, Vitamin C 110mg, Beta-carotene 1.5mg.

Hill's Prescription Diet ON-Care with Chicken Dry Dog Food is a complete and balanced food that provides the nutritional support your dog needs.

Please consult your veterinarian for further information on how our Prescription Diet foods can help support your dog's quality of life.

For best results, consistent long term feeding of this product is critical.

Dry and canned formulas can be mixed or fed concurrently.
